The early stages of drug discovery involve identification, selection and optimization of drug candidates. The applications of high performance liquid chromatography-tandem mass spectrometry (LC/MS/MS) assays have become an extremely useful analytical chemistry tool. Combining LC/MS/MS with proper in vitro and in vivo study designs can accelerate the transition from discovery through pre-clinical development. The Q-TRAP® LC/MS/MS system is an enhanced high performance triple quadrupole mass spectrometer with a mass range of 5-3000 mass units making it an essential tool for small molecule drug discovery. The Q-TRAP® is ideal for drug level analysis in complex matrices in drug discovery and development studies including pharmacokinetic/toxicokinetic (PK/TK), pharmacokinetic/ pharmacodynamic (PK/PD) correlation, tissue distribution, cassette dosing, plasma/matrix stability, metabolic stability, as well as protein and peptide analysis.
